History and Foundations

Te Wananga o Aotearoa, often shortened to TWoA, traces its roots to 1983. It began as a small initiative in the Taranaki region. Its founders envisioned a different kind of educational institution. They wanted to prioritize Māori aspirations. Furthermore, they aimed to provide accessible learning opportunities. The core mission involved empowering Māori communities. It also sought to foster cultural pride and knowledge. TWoA operates as a private, tertiary institution. It is registered with the New Zealand Qualifications Authority. Its establishment reflects a deep commitment to cultural revitalization. Moreover, it underscores a desire for educational equity. This foundation guides all its endeavors.

Unique Programs and Features

TWoA distinguishes itself through several unique aspects. Its core philosophy centers on Tīkanga Māori. This indigenous worldview infuses all its teachings. Consequently, students gain a deep understanding of Māori culture. The institution offers specialized programs. For instance, its Marae-based learning experiences are renowned. These immerse students in traditional settings. Moreover, they provide practical cultural immersion. TWoA also champions lifelong learning. It offers flexible study options. These cater to working professionals. Therefore, more people can access education. Its graduates are sought after. They embody both cultural understanding and modern expertise.
